How should we pray for young believers? The Apostle Paul instructs us in his letters to young churches. Writing to the church at Thessalonica, Paul says that thanksgiving is a foundational prayer (1 Thessalonians 1:2–10). He thanks God for the amazing grace of God already displayed in their lives at salvation, in their changed lives (1 Thessalonians 1:6-7; 2 Thessalonians 2:13-14), and for the glory to come (1 Thessalonians 3:9). Young believers often have a lot of baggage, and thanksgiving grounds us when our equilibrium gets off in our attitude towards those to whom we minister.
Paul also emphasizes intercessory prayer (accessing spiritual grace and power for others), committing himself to continual prayer for this young church (1 Thessalonians 1:2; 2 Thessalonians 1:1). His focus was on their spiritual needs.
